F-1/A: Siyata Mobile Eyes $9.8 Million in Best-Efforts Offering to Fuel Growth

Siyata Mobile launches a best-efforts offering of up to 7 million common shares and pre-funded warrants to bolster its financial position and support general corporate purposes.

Capital raiseThe company is offering up to 7,000,000 common shares and/or pre-funded warrants in a best-efforts offering.The offering price is $1.40 per common share, with pre-funded warrants priced at $1.39.The company aims to use the net proceeds for general corporate purposes, including potential acquisitions.The company has been involved in recent securities purchase agreements and offerings to raise capital.
Worse than expectedThe company's auditor has expressed substantial doubt about its ability to continue as a going concern.The company has identified material weaknesses in its internal controls over financial reporting.

Summary

  • Siyata Mobile Inc. is launching a best-efforts offering to sell up to 7,000,000 common shares and/or pre-funded warrants.
  • The offering aims to raise capital for general corporate purposes, including potential acquisitions and working capital.
  • The price is set at $1.40 per common share, with pre-funded warrants available at $1.39 each.
  • The company has engaged Spartan Capital Securities, LLC as the exclusive placement agent.
  • The offering has no minimum amount required to close.
  • Net proceeds are estimated to be up to $9,298,559 if all shares are sold at the assumed price.
  • The company has a history of operating losses and its auditor has raised concerns about its ability to continue as a going concern.
  • The company has identified material weaknesses in its internal controls over financial reporting.
  • The company has been involved in recent securities purchase agreements and offerings to raise capital.
  • The company has been awarded a new patent by the United States Patent and Trademark Office for its VK7 Vehicle Kit.

Industry Context

Siyata Mobile operates in the B2B market for ruggedized cellular devices and accessories, targeting enterprise and public sector workers. The company competes with other rugged device manufacturers and traditional LMR radio providers. The market is shifting from LMR to PoC solutions, with the PoC market projected to reach $7 billion by 2027.

Comparison to Industry Standards

  • Siyata competes with Sonim Technologies, Kyocera, and Samsung in the rugged handset market.
  • Unlike competitors, Siyata offers a unique solution with the SD7 Handset and VK7 Vehicle Kit.
  • Siyata's solutions are positioned as a simple upgrade from traditional two-way radios.
  • The company also competes with low-cost PoC devices from Chinese companies like Telo and Inrico, primarily in international markets.
  • In the in-vehicle category, Siyata competes with handheld phones with car kits, rugged tablets, and in-vehicle LMR radios.

Key Dates

DateDescription
October 15, 1986Company incorporated as Big Rock Gold Ltd.
December 2012Signifi Mobile enters into a license agreement with Uniden America Corporation.
July 24, 2015Teslin River Resources Corp. acquired certain telecom operations and changed its name to Siyata Mobile Inc.
June 7, 2016Company acquired all of the issued and outstanding shares of Signifi Mobile Inc.
October 1, 2017Company entered into an Asset Purchase Agreement with eWave Mobile Ltd.
January 1, 2018Signifi Mobile Inc. entered into an agreement with Wilson Electronics, LLC to utilize several of Wilson Electronics patents related to cellphone boosters.
June 8, 2018Company entered into two separate licensing agreements with Via Licensing Corporation to utilize worldwide patents related to the coding and decoding of android software as well as access and download within the LTE/ 4G network.
July 1, 2018Company entered into a consulting agreement with BSD Ltd. and Marc Seelenfreund.
November 26, 2018Company entered into a consulting agreement with Glenn Kennedy.
January 1, 2020Company entered into a consulting agreement with Gidi Bracha.
September 24, 2020Company effected a reverse share split of its issued and outstanding Common Shares on the basis of one (1) Common Share for one hundred and forty-five (145) Common Shares.
March 31, 2021Company acquired all of the issued and outstanding interests of Clear RF, LLC.
August 9, 2023Company effected a reverse share split of its issued and outstanding Common Shares on the basis of one (1) Common Share for one hundred (100) Common Shares.
December 4, 2023Company effected a reverse share split of its issued and outstanding Common Shares on the basis of one (1) Common Share for seven (7) Common Shares.
January 29, 2024Company entered into a securities purchase agreement with an institutional investor.
April 9, 2024Company entered into a Securities Purchase Agreement with an institutional investor.
April 17, 2024Company entered into a Securities Purchase Agreement with another institutional investor.
May 7, 2024Company announced that it had entered into a Securities Purchase Agreement with certain investors named therein.
May 15, 2024Mr. Peter Goldstein, a member of the board of directors of the Company resigned from his position as the Chairman and Director of the Company.
June 5, 2024Company entered into a Securities Purchase Agreement with an institutional investor.
June 5, 2024Company entered into a Securities Purchase Agreement with another institutional investor.
June 11, 2024Company received a demand letter from a law firm representing a financial advisory firm seeking to collect $457,477 relating to an unpaid invoice for financial services allegedly rendered by such firm.
